The Anatomy of Demo Play: A Risk-Free Exploration
Demo play, also known as “free play” or “practice mode,” provides a sandbox environment for exploring online casino games without risking your own money. It’s the digital equivalent of a test drive, allowing you to familiarize yourself with the game’s rules, features, and payout structures. The primary advantage is, of course, the absence of financial risk. You’re given a virtual balance, often a substantial amount, to wager with. This allows you to experiment with different betting strategies, understand the volatility of a particular slot, or learn the intricacies of a new table game. For example, you can try out Martingale strategy on roulette without the fear of losing your bankroll. This is especially useful when encountering a new game variant. Demo play is an excellent tool for learning the ropes and developing a feel for the game before committing real funds.
However, it is important to acknowledge the limitations. The most obvious is the absence of real winnings. While you can accumulate a substantial virtual balance, you cannot cash it out. The psychological aspect is also different; the stakes are lower, and the emotional response to winning or losing is significantly diminished. This can lead to a less realistic assessment of your performance and potentially a false sense of security. Moreover, some games may have slightly altered payout percentages or features in demo mode compared to their real-money counterparts, although this is less common with reputable online casinos.

The Realm of Real Money Play: Where the Stakes are Real
Real money play is where the true excitement lies. This is where you wager your own funds, and the potential for real winnings exists. The stakes are higher, the adrenaline flows, and the psychological impact of both winning and losing is amplified. This is where your skills, strategies, and bankroll management are truly tested. The potential for financial reward is the primary draw, but it’s also important to acknowledge the inherent risks involved. Responsible gambling becomes paramount, and a clear understanding of your limits is essential. The thrill of winning a significant sum is undeniable, and it’s this very prospect that drives the popularity of online casinos.
Real money play demands a different level of discipline. You must carefully manage your bankroll, set loss limits, and avoid chasing losses. Understanding the house edge of each game is crucial, as is knowing when to walk away. The emotional rollercoaster of real money play can be intense, and it’s essential to maintain a level head and make rational decisions. Furthermore, the availability of bonuses and promotions adds another layer of complexity. While these can enhance your bankroll, they often come with wagering requirements and other terms and conditions that must be carefully considered.

Strategic Implications and Practical Recommendations for Experienced Gamblers
For the seasoned gambler, the distinction between demo play and real money play is not merely academic; it has significant strategic implications. Demo play should be viewed as a valuable tool for game exploration and strategy refinement. Before committing real money to a new game, take the time to familiarize yourself with its mechanics in demo mode. Experiment with different betting strategies, analyze the game’s volatility, and identify any potential pitfalls. This will allow you to approach real money play with a more informed and strategic mindset.
When transitioning to real money play, always start with small stakes. This allows you to test your strategies and get a feel for the game without risking a significant portion of your bankroll. Set clear loss limits and stick to them. Avoid chasing losses, as this is a surefire way to deplete your funds. Take advantage of casino bonuses and promotions, but always read the terms and conditions carefully. Understand the wagering requirements and any other restrictions that may apply. Finally, and perhaps most importantly, gamble responsibly. Recognize the signs of problem gambling and seek help if needed. Remember that gambling should be a form of entertainment, not a means of making a living.
